Topic: Can I use Advanced Home version on different computers but same controller?

I bought a Denon MC4000 and I a thinking about trying Virtual DJ with it. I have two PC's and would like to be able to use either of the two PC's with the one controller... Is that possible if I make a one time purchase for the "Advanced Homer User" controller specific version?

Yes, the Plus license (Advanced Home) will unlock your controller to any computer you install VirtualDJ and login with your account credentials.

Thank you for that. But then does that mean I need to have internet access each time to log in? For example if I'm at my parents' where there's no internet....?

If there is no internet access then a logged in machine will stay logged in.
